c语言int占几个字节 vc,int类型占几个字节

c语言int占几个字节 vc,int类型占几个字节在 java 中 int 类型占四个字节 而 byte 类型占一个字节在 java 中 int 类型占四个字节 而 byte 类型占一个字节 这句话在内存中怎不是的 你这是理解错误 也是被混洧了 是初学者最容易犯的错 int 四字节没错 byte 一字节也没错但一个字节有 8 位哦 先看 byte byte 占一字节 一字节等于八位我们来看看一个位能表示多少东西 最小 0 最大 1 表示 2 的 1 次方再看看两个位能表示 i

在java中,int类型占四个字节,而byte类型占一个字节

在java中,int类型占四个字节,而byte类型占一个字节。这句话在内存中怎不是的,你这是理解错误,也是被混洧了,是初学者最容易犯的错。 int 四字节没错 byte一字节也没错 但一个字节有8位哦。 先看byte,byte占一字节,一字节等于八位 我们来看看一个位能表示多少东西: 最小0 最大1 表示 2的1次方 再看看两个位能表示

int有short int,int,long int三种形式,它们分别占多少字节?如果只输在C/C++语言中,int和long int的所占的字节数与编译器有关。 不过现在常用的编译器多认为int和long int相同,均为4字节,short为2字节,char为1字节。 如果只输入int,它是可以包含以上三种形式。 不同的语言不太一样,例如在Pascal中integer为2

6d67d1ff49e317de0b6a07a46277053e.png

c#中整数类型数据int占几个字节?

int有好几种:Int16 Int32 Int64 意义同名,分别占16位,32位,64位 8位一字节,所以分别占2字节,4字节,8字节 C#对整数做了基元类型: short映射Int16 int映射Int32 long映射Int64 int即Int32 即:4字节

int float char分别占几个字节

int类型占用4字节内存,表示整数,数据范围在-2^31~2^31-1(-~)之间。 float类型占用4字节内存,表示小数,数据范围在-2^128 ~ 2^128(-3.40E+38 ~ +3.40E+38 )之间。 char类型占用1字节内存,表示字符。

C语言的int占几个字节,char占几个字节?

char :1个字节; char*(即指针变量):4个字节(32位的寻址空间是2^32, 即32个bit,也就是4个字节。同理64位编译器); short int:2个字节; int:4个字节; unsigned int :4个字; float: 4个字节; double:8个字节; long:4个字节; long long:8个字节; un

int字型在32位机里占几个字节?

占4字节 在TC里,int是2字节的(主要是因为TC是16位的,所以int类型也该是16位的) VC++里,int是4字节的,因为现代操作系统下的软件大多是是32位。 64位的VC++,本来按理说,该是8字节的,但是可能为了维持32位的源代码移植到64位尽量不出错。

int型变量所占的内存到底是4字节还是2字节?

课本上将的都是占2字节,但是我在看结构体内存对齐的时候,上面是long,在TC里,int是2字节的(主要是因为TC是16位的,所以int类型也该是16位的) VC++里,int是4字节的,因为现代操作系统下的软件大多是是32位。 64位的VC++,本来按理说,该是8字节的,但是可能为了维持32位的源代码移植到64位尽量不出错。

为什么int类型在16位系统中占2个字节,在32

所谓的16位32位64位系统是由cpu决定的,由机器指令的寻址、寄存器位数决定的 os受cpu的限制,但在32位的cpu下16位的os也可以跑(就向上面提到的所谓纯dos) 很多os是向前兼容的,就是使以前的程序也能运行,如果编译器本身是16位时代做的。

选择.设C语言中,int类型数据占2个字节,则short类型short是占两个字节。 short在C语言中是定义一种整型变量家族的一种,shorti;表示定义一个短整型的变量i。 依据程序编译器的不同short定义的字节数不同,标准定义short短整型变量不得低于16位,即两个字节,编译器头文件夹里面的limits.h定义了s

java中 (int,long,flloat,double等在计算机占几个如题,。

表示这个数据在内存中要占多大的空间,如一个int数据在内存中占4个字节,而1024个字节=1KB,1024KB=1MB,1024MB=1GB,你的内存是几G的其实就是这样算的,不过产家一般是以1000为单位,而这些数据类型占多少个字节其实就是说所占你内存空间的多少

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/201520.html原文链接:https://javaforall.net

(0)
上一篇 2026年3月20日 上午9:12
下一篇 2026年3月20日 上午9:13


相关推荐

  • Android手机端编程开发软件合集(一)

    Android手机端编程开发软件合集(一)在网上搜索了很久才找到的编程IDE高级解锁版,在这里记录并分享一下吧!一、合集地址:蓝奏云:https://huanxingke.lanzous.com/b0203kqjg密码:flyingdream二、软件合集截图如下:三、软件的一些介绍:★文件1:【QPython3H.apk】(1)Python编辑器。(2)优点:文件交互简单,界面简洁友好,支持androidhelper,可以很方便地调用Android的API。(3)缺点:支持的第三方库较少,无代码预测。(4)网上的介绍:

    2022年5月24日
    49
  • 中国高校那些不为人知的秘密,你听说过吗?

    中国高校那些不为人知的秘密,你听说过吗?开学季 新生们别以为踏入大学的校门就一切准备好 这些校园的秘密你知道吗 1 中国人民大学我们学校的校徽是这个样子的对吧 多么正经 人畜无害 实际上 我们学校校徽的立意是这样的但是 别人看我们的校徽 眼神都是这样的是这样的 是这样的

    2026年3月19日
    2
  • 【JOURNAL】修辞

    【JOURNAL】修辞

    2021年7月26日
    65
  • PHP实现二叉树的深度优先遍历(前序、中序、后序)和广度优先遍历(层次)…

    PHP实现二叉树的深度优先遍历(前序、中序、后序)和广度优先遍历(层次)…

    2022年2月11日
    40
  • WLAN 与WIFI的区别?

    WLAN 与WIFI的区别?一、WIFIWIFI是一种可以将个人电脑、手持设备(如PDA、手机)等终端以无线方式互相连接的技术。WIFI技术与蓝牙技术一样,同属于在办公室和家庭中使用的短距离无线技术。Wi-Fi原先是无线保真的缩写,Wi-Fi的英文全称为wirelessfidelity,在无线局域网的范畴是指“无线相容性认证”,实质上是一种商业认证,同时也是一种无线联网的技术,以前通过网线连接电脑,而现在则…

    2022年7月11日
    20
  • bat 剪切文件_bat延时命令

    bat 剪切文件_bat延时命令扩展名是bat(在nt/2000/xp/2003下也可以是cmd)的文件就是批处理文件。首先批处理文件是一个文本文件,这个文件的每一行都是一条DOS命令(大部分时候就好象我们在DOS提示符下执行的命令行一样),你可以使用DOS下的Edit或者Windows的记事本(notepad)等任何文本文件编辑工具创建和修改批处理文件。其次,批处理文件是一种简单的程序,可以通过条件语句(if)和流程控制语句(…

    2026年3月2日
    7

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号